For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 1,161 students in 78256, TX.
The top-ranked public schools in 78256, TX are Ellison Elementary School and May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 78256 have an average math proficiency score of 48% (versus the Texas public school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 57% (versus the 51% statewide average). Schools in 78256, TX have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Texas public schools.
Minority enrollment is 84%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
